1. Visual Basic - Curso completo teoria y practica
1. Visual Basic - Curso completo teoria y practica 1. Visual Basic - Curso completo teoria y practica
TxtCurCodigo.Enabled = True TxtCurCodigo.SetFocus End Sub Private Sub CmdAceptar_Click() Dim Rs As New ADODB.Recordset Set Rs = Cn.Execute(“Select CurNombre, ” & _ “CurVacantes, CurProfe From Curso ” & _ “Where CurCodigo = '” & TxtCurCodigo & “'”) If (Rs.EOF And Rs.BOF) Then MsgBox “No existe ningún curso con este código” TxtCurCodigo.SetFocus TxtCurCodigo.SelStart = 0 TxtCurCodigo.SelLength = Len(TxtCurCodigo) Exit Sub End If TxtCurNombre = Rs!CurNombre TxtCurVacantes = Rs!CurVacantes TxtCurProfe = Rs!CurProfe Rs.Close Set Rs = Nothing TxtCurCodigo.Enabled = False CmdAceptar.Enabled = False CmdEliminar.Enabled = True CmdNuevo.Enabled = True End Sub Private Sub CmdCerrar_Click() Unload Me End Sub De manera similar proceda a desarrollar el código para los formularios de mantenimiento de las demás tablas. Pág. 344
Aplicación Nº 4 Elaborar una aplicación que permita recuperar y mantener la información de la base de datos CursosLibres.MDB. Para tal fin debe preparar un formulario que permita establecer la conexión con el origen de datos. Luego, si la conexión es satisfactoria el usuario tiene la posibilidad de elegir una de las tablas de la base de datos para realizar las operaciones habituales de mantenimiento o simplemente para ejecutar consultas. El diseño de la interfaz debe ser similar a la siguiente figura: Las opciones Mantenimiento y Consulta deben ser análogas a las realizadas en aplicaciones anteriores. Microsoft Visual Basic Pág. 345
- Page 293 and 294: En ese instante se añadirá un nue
- Page 295 and 296: indica: Form2 List1 Command1 Luego
- Page 297 and 298: Del cuadro de diálogo Agregar form
- Page 299 and 300: Private Sub MnuFixedSingle_Click()
- Page 301 and 302: GUÍA DE LABORATORIO Parte II ELABO
- Page 303 and 304: GUÍA DE LABORATORIO Nº 6 Objetivo
- Page 305 and 306: CurCodigo CurNombre CurProfe BC1 Bo
- Page 307 and 308: la base de datos CursosLibres.MDB.
- Page 309 and 310: otón Siguiente. En seguida aparece
- Page 311 and 312: Frame2 Frame3 Nombre FraIngreso Cap
- Page 313 and 314: Command5 Command6 Command7 Command8
- Page 315 and 316: ModoEditar True End Sub Private Sub
- Page 317 and 318: Desarrollar una aplicación que per
- Page 319 and 320: Desarrollar una aplicación que per
- Page 321 and 322: Aplicación Nº 4 Desarrollar una a
- Page 323 and 324: Para el diseño de la interfaz, pro
- Page 325 and 326: Text Para establecer las propiedade
- Page 327 and 328: TxtCurNombre.DataField = “CurNomb
- Page 329 and 330: Para el desarrollo de esta aplicaci
- Page 331 and 332: RsCurso.LockType = adLockReadOnly R
- Page 333 and 334: Para desarrollar nuestra aplicació
- Page 335 and 336: Form1 Label1 Label2 Label3 Label4 T
- Page 337 and 338: Private Sub CmdNuevo_Click() TxtCur
- Page 339 and 340: Command1 Command2 Command3 Command4
- Page 341 and 342: End Sub Private Sub CmdCerrar_Click
- Page 343: Command3 Command4 Caption &Eliminar
- Page 347 and 348: un Comando y denomínelo CmCurso. E
- Page 349 and 350: Etiqueta6 Font Arial (Negrita 10) N
- Page 351 and 352: A continuación sobre el diseñador
- Page 353 and 354: Form1 Frame1 Option1 Option2 Option
- Page 355 and 356: Private Sub CmdSalir_Click() Unload
- Page 357 and 358: La presente Guía de Laboratorio de
- Page 359 and 360: La ventana de código de la clase d
- Page 361 and 362: Dim A As Circulo Private Sub Form_L
- Page 363 and 364: Nombre FrmPruebaMiControl Caption P
- Page 365 and 366: En seguida, guarde y ejecute su apl
- Page 367 and 368: Luego, haga click sobre la opción
- Page 369 and 370: Ahora hemos llegado a la ventana en
- Page 371 and 372: Proyecto1 Nombre ActiveXNumBox User
- Page 373 and 374: ejemplo 5 de Setiembre de 1752. El
- Page 375 and 376: usuario: A continuación proceda a
- Page 377 and 378: Command1 Nombre BdgrdTabla Font Ari
- Page 379 and 380: Case 0 Call MostrarAlumno Case 1 Ca
- Page 381 and 382: ingrese en el cuadro de texto adjun
- Page 383 and 384: Objetivos capaz de: Luego de comple
- Page 385 and 386: Para crear la interfaz de la aplica
- Page 387 and 388: TxtTabla.Value = S Else TxtTabla.Va
- Page 389 and 390: Luego haga click en el botón Acept
- Page 391 and 392: Button2 Button3 Button4 Nombre CmdA
- Page 393 and 394: DeCursosLibres.rsCmCurso.MoveFirst
Aplicación Nº 4<br />
Elaborar una aplicación que permita recuperar y mantener<br />
la información de la base de datos <strong>Curso</strong>sLibres.MDB. Para tal<br />
fin debe preparar un formulario que permita establecer la<br />
conexión con el origen de datos. Luego, si la conexión es<br />
satisfactoria el usuario tiene la posibilidad de elegir una de<br />
las tablas de la base de datos para realizar las operaciones<br />
habituales de mantenimiento o simplemente para ejecutar<br />
consultas. El diseño de la interfaz debe ser similar a la<br />
siguiente figura:<br />
Las opciones Mantenimiento y Consulta deben ser análogas a<br />
las realizadas en aplicaciones anteriores.<br />
Microsoft <strong>Visual</strong> <strong>Basic</strong><br />
Pág. 345